Methods: Patients undergoing jawbone reconstruction with the modified vascularized free iliac bone flap between January 2022 and February 2023 were recruited. Maxillofacial spiral CT scans were collected at 1 week, 6 months, and 1 year postoperatively. The nascent cortical bone thickness, total bone thickness, and cancellous bone density of the iliac bone flap were measured at three specified planes on the spiral CT images. Results: Seven patients were recruited for bone remodeling analysis. Cortical bone regeneration was observed at the iliac bone in all patients. At 1 year postoperatively, the mean cortical bone thickening was 1.18 mm, 1.17 mm, and 1.01 mm at the three measurement planes, respectively. Significant increases were noted in the overall thickness of the iliac bone and the cancellous bone density were reduced significantly at 6 months compared to 1 week postoperatively. From 6 months to 1 year postoperatively, there was a slight increase in cortical bone thickness and a further decrease in cancellous bone density. Conclusion: The modified vascularized free iliac flap shows gradual increases in cortical bone thickness and total iliac bone thickness, along with a gradual decrease in cancellous bone density. The bone remodeling is more active in the first 6 months after surgery. The modified vascularized free iliac flap represents a viable alternative for jaw reconstruction. Jaw reconstruction Vascularized free iliac flap Cortical bone Bone remodeling Figures Figure 1 Figure 2 Introduction The maxilla and mandible constitute vital bony components within the maxillofacial region, integral to various anatomical structures and essential physiological functions such as mastication, swallowing, speech, and respiration[ 1 ]. To address maxillofacial defects arising from tumors, trauma, or surgical interventions, vascularized free flaps represent the predominant restorative approach, offering superior restoration of both form and function. Several types of vascularized free flaps have proven effective in maxillofacial reconstruction, with the vascularized free fibula and iliac flaps being the most frequently utilized[ 2 – 5 ]. The free fibula flap offers advantages including larger vessel diameters, facile multi-segmental osteotomy, and contouring capabilities, with low donor-site complications[ 6 , 7 ]. However, its limited soft-tissue volume may prove inadequate for defect filling. Moreover, the width of the fibula typically falls short of that required for jawbone reconstruction, potentially necessitating additional surgical intervention for subsequent implantation. Conversely, the iliac flap capitalizes on its naturally curved iliac crest, which resembles the physiological curvature of the mandible, and offers sufficient bone height and thickness conducive to implant integration[ 3 , 8 ]. Nevertheless, challenges associated with the iliac flap include limited donor bone length, narrow vascular pedicle, and higher incidence of donor-site complications. Modification of the iliac flap, preserving the lateral cortical bone, and utilizing a rotary deep iliac artery to carry the medial cortical bone may reduce complications associated with vascularized free iliac flaps. Taylor et al.[ 9 ] applied a sagittal split iliac flap in a 13-year-old patient with hemifacial microsomia to preserve the normal contour and donor site development. David et al.[ 10 ] reported the use of the "split iliac flap" in 5 patients with various diagnoses and concluded that the split ilium is not too bulky. This modified iliac flap offers potential advantages over conventional techniques: first, preserving the lateral cortical bone to minimize donor site damage and complications; and second, allowing more precise control over the bone thickness of the harvested flap for improved restoration of craniofacial aesthetics. With the advancement of computer-assisted surgery (CAS), reconstructive procedures have benefited from enhanced accuracy and predictability[ 11 ], and facilitates a more precise determination of iliac bone flap thickness required for maxillofacial reconstruction. Additionally, several studies have demonstrated varying degrees of bone resorption following vascularized free bone grafting, which may adversely affect the subsequent placement of dental implants[ 12 , 13 ]. It is noteworthy that modified vascularized free iliac flap shows noticeable new cortical bone formation on the split side of the iliac bone flap. Currently, there are no reports on bone remodeling outcomes following the use of modified vascularized free iliac flaps for jaw reconstructions. In this prospective study, we longitudinally observed and measured bone remodeling of the iliac bone flap after jaw reconstruction with modified vascularized free iliac flap and investigated factors that may influence bone remodeling. This prospective study was conducted from January 2022 to February 2023 at the Department of Oral and Maxillofacial Surgery, Peking University School and Hospital of Stomatology, including patients with benign or malignant tumors of the maxillofacial region who underwent mandibular or maxillary reconstruction using modified vascularized iliac bone flaps. Preoperative counseling was provided to patients who provided informed consent by signing the consent forms. The inclusion criteria were as follows: 1) age between 18 and 80 years, tumors involving the soft and hard tissues of the oral and maxillofacial region requiring jaw resection, 2) periosteum removal during surgery, 3) jaw reconstruction using modified vascularized iliac bone flaps, and 4) absence of significant surgical contraindications. Patients meeting any of the following conditions were excluded: 1) postoperative spiral computed tomography (CT) images showing bilateral cortical bone in the iliac flap, which affected measurements of new cortical bone formation; 2) patients who underwent flap replacement postoperatively due to vascular compromise or other factors; and 3) interference with measurement caused by titanium plate and screw artifacts on postoperative CT images. Surgical procedure All patients underwent preoperative maxillofacial CT scans (field of view, 20 cm; pitch, 1.0; slice thickness, 1.25 mm; 140–160 mA, pixel density, 512 × 512), and virtual surgical planning (VSP) was generated using ProPlan CMF 3.0 software (Materialise, Leuven, Belgium). Mirror models were used to simulate jaw reconstruction and to preliminarily determine the required iliac bone flap thickness (Fig. 1 . a). Surgical guides and jaw reconstruction models were designed using the Mimics Medical software (version 21.0; Materialize, Leuven, Belgium). During the surgery, the donor site on one side of the buttock was padded. A deep circumflex iliac artery perforator myofascial flap was prepared intraoperatively, involving the dissection of the internal oblique, transversus abdominis, and rectus abdominis muscles. The deep circumflex iliac artery was dissected in reverse at the medial aspect of the anterior superior iliac spine with preservation of the lateral cutaneous nerve of the thigh and transection of the iliacus muscle. The lateral periosteum of the iliac crest was stripped to expose the outer bone and a bone-cutting guide was placed and fixed. The iliac crest was cut based on the cutting guide, preserving a 3–5 mm outer cortical bone plate, and longitudinally split (Fig. 1 . b). The cortical bone was cut at the inner lower edge (Fig. 1 .c) to obtain the required iliac bone segment (Fig. 1 . d), with a vascularized deep circumflex iliac artery iliac flap incorporating the inner cortical bone (Fig. 1 . e). Pre-bent titanium plates were used with three-dimensional (3D) printed jaw reconstruction models to assist jaw reconstruction (Fig. 1 . f). Imaging analysis Postoperative follow-up was scheduled at 1 week, 6 months, and 1 year, with maxillofacial spiral CT imaging performed at the Peking University School and Hospital of Stomatology. Observations and measurements of spiral CT images were conducted using the PACS archiving and communication system at the Peking University School and Hospital of Stomatology. The iliac flap was examined in the bone window (800 Hounsfield units (HU)). The viewing axis was adjusted so that one axis was parallel to the long axis of the flap and another axis intersected perpendicularly through the iliac flap. After adjusting the viewing axis, horizontal planes were marked in the sagittal window at distances of 5 and 10 mm from the iliac crest and 5 mm from the distal end of the iliac flap. These planes represent the postoperative bone reconstruction at the levels of the alveolar ridge (Ar level), root end of the implant (Ri level), and end of the iliac flap (Ei level). Measurements of CT images were performed 1 week, 6 months, and 1 year postoperatively (Figs. 1 . a, d, g). Cortical bone thickness was calculated by dividing the area by the length. The "freehand ROI" tool of the software was used to meticulously outline the area of cortical bone, and the "line" tool was used to measure the observable length of cortical bone. In cases where titanium screws were present in the measurement plane, the cortical bone thickness was measured, excluding the titanium screw portions. Cortical bone thickness was measured 1 week, 6 months, and 1 year postoperatively (Figs. 1 . b, e, h). The overall thickness of the iliac flap was measured as follows: using the "line" tool, the length of the iliac flap was measured, and the flap was divided into four equal parts based on total length. The thickness of the flap was measured at three points along these division lines, and the average value represented the thickness of the iliac flap at that plane. Cancellous bone density was quantitatively evaluated using the Hounsfield units. On the observation plane, using the "ellipse" tool, three circles with an area of approximately 4 mm² were outlined at the midpoint of each division line. If a circle was close to the image of the titanium plates or screws, it was positioned at least 5 mm away from them. The average spiral CT value represented the cancellous bone density at the measurement plane. Cortical bone thickness and overall bone flap thickness were measured 1 week, 6 months, and 1 year postoperatively (Figs. 2 .c, f, i). All measurements were independently conducted by three researchers and the average of their measurements was taken as the final measurement result. Seven patients underwent a successful jaw defect repair using the modified flap technique. Spiral CT images at one week postoperatively revealed absence of cortical bone on one side of the modified vascularized iliac bone flap, with noticeable cortical bone regeneration observed at one year postoperatively. At six months post-operation, the cortical bone thickness increased by 1.03 mm, 0.79 mm, and 0.90 mm at the Ar, Ri, and Ei levels, respectively. Continued cortical thickening was noted during 6 months and 1 year postoperatively, with increases of 0.19 mm, 0.28 mm, and 0.09 mm at the same levels. These findings indicate that cortical bone thickening primarily occurs within the first six months post-operation, which is consistent with current research[ 14 ]. Previous studies have reported varying degrees of absorption following vascularized free-flap mandibular or maxillary reconstruction. Kang et al.[ 13 ] reported cortical bone loss rates of 21%, 17%, 10%, and 31% at one year post-operation for the lateral, medial, superior, and inferior aspects of vascularized fibular flaps, respectively, while Chen et al.[ 15 ] found a 9.1% decrease in total iliac bone thickness at one year post-operation. Similar results have been reported by Shokri et al.[ 16 ]. This study is the first to document an increasing trend in the bone flap thickness after jaw defect repair using a vascularized free bone flap. The newly formed cortical bone contributes to an overall increase in bone flap thickness, following a pattern similar to cortical bone thickness change. It is noteworthy that the total iliac bone thickness increase was lower than the increase in cortical bone areas, indicating concurrent bone absorption elsewhere following modified iliac bone flap surgery. Regarding cancellous bone density changes, the results align with previous literature[ 17 – 19 ], showing a declining trend with reductions of 84.9%, 77.7%, and 80.4% within six months relative to one year, similar to the findings of Chen et al.[ 15 ]. Cancellous bone density further declined in the second six months post-operation. Measurements at the three selected levels conformed to the aforementioned patterns of bone remodeling. Considering these patterns comprehensively, the initial six months post-modified iliac bone flap surgery exhibited active bone remodeling. By six months, cortical bone thickness and overall flap thickness stabilize, reaching 0.79 mm and 7.75 mm at the Ri level, respectively. Meanwhile, cancellous bone density continues to decline, underscoring the optimal timing for implant surgery on the modified vascularized free iliac bone flap at six months postoperatively to mitigate further density loss that could impact implant outcomes. While previous discussion noted that cortical bone thickness increases more than total iliac bone thickness, Case 1 shows increases in iliac bone flap thickness at Ar and Ri levels exceeding cortical bone increases, contrary to the general trend. This may be related to the daily use of irbesartan for cardiovascular disease in Case 1. Cheng et al.[ 20 ] demonstrated that irbesartan has the potential to reduce reactive oxygen species and inhibit advanced glycation end-product formation in rats, thus reducing bone absorption. Liu et al.[ 21 ] demonstrated that irbesartan partially altered bone remodeling and enhanced bone quality, primarily affecting trabecular bone. In addition, Case 3 exhibited significantly lower increases in cortical bone and bone flap thickness compared to other patients, with a decreasing trend in bone flap thickness at the crest of the alveolar ridge, which we attributed to the method of internal fixation. This case utilized a dual-layer reconstruction plate for fixation, where the oversized titanium plate volume may have induced stress shielding at the site, thereby affecting the bone remodeling processes[ 22 , 23 ]. Xie et al. [ 24 ] found that larger mini-titanium plates may correlate with increased bone absorption following condylar fractures compared with micro-titanium plates. Similarly, Case 7, also fixed with bilateral reconstruction plates, showed lower cortical bone formation and increased bone flap thickness. However, in addition to the fixation materials, case 7 also experienced post-operative site infection, which likely influenced the bone remodeling process[ 25 ]. Statistical analysis of the factors affecting bone remodeling is presented in Table 5 . The reconstruction site had no significant impact on bone remodeling, which is consistent with the findings of Hölzle et al.[ 26 ] and Disa et al.[ 27 ]. Factors such as tumor type, type of internal fixation titanium plates, post-operative complications, radiotherapy, chemotherapy, and systemic medications showed no apparent association with bone remodeling. Compared with the commonly used free fibula flap and traditional iliac flap, the modified vascularized free iliac flap demonstrates a postoperative trend of increasing thickness, highlighting one of its advantages. Additionally, the split side of the modified iliac flap showed new cortical bone formation, which is advantageous for implant placement. For instance, at the Ri level, the iliac bone flap thickness increased by 7% at 6 months and 9% at 1 year postoperatively, suggesting that during preoperative VSP, an iliac bone flap of less than the desired thickness can be designed according to the appropriate proportions, which may be beneficial in minimizing surgical injury. Furthermore, since the iliac bone thickness continues to increase slowly at 1 year postoperatively, assessment of flap thickness can be re-evaluated at 1 year if inadequate thickness for implantation is noted at 6 months postoperatively. In summary, the modified vascularized free iliac flap is a viable option for maxillofacial reconstructions. However, this study had certain limitations. The data collected did not follow a normal distribution, precluding further multivariate analyses. The number of cases included in this study was relatively small, particularly those with CT imaging data at six months postoperatively. Future research with larger sample sizes is necessary to validate bone remodeling outcomes following the modified vascularized free iliac flap procedure. Conclusions This prospective study provides the first report on bone remodeling patterns following surgery with a modified vascularized free iliac flap, along with an analysis of the influencing factors. Postoperatively, new cortical bone formation was observed on the split side of the modified flap, contributing to a gradual increase in the overall flap thickness, albeit with a concurrent decrease in flap density. Bone remodeling is most active within the first 6 months post-surgery, with substantial remodeling generally completed by 6 months, making it an optimal period for subsequent implantation procedures on the modified vascularized free iliac flap.
